Lukefahr, Martha L. (nee Schrumpf)

A funeral will be held Wednesday, September 20th, for 89-year-old Martha L. Lukefahr of Highland, who died Sunday, September 17th at Perry County Memorial Hospital.

She was born October 16th, 1910 in Old Appleton, the daughter of Henry and Rosella (Ross) Schrumpf who both preceded in death.

She married Clarence J. Lukefahr on October 26th, 1940. He preceded in death.

She is survived by five sons: George J. Lukefahr and Steve C. Lukefahr, both of Perryville; Paul T. Lukefahr and Pete J. Lukefahr, both of Highland; and Ray H. Lukefahr of Centralia, Illinois.

Two daughters also survive her: Rose H. Lappe of Perryville and Charlotte A. Miget of Highland.

One brother also survives: Walter Schrumpf of Perryville.

Thirteen grandchildren, 12 great grandchildren, four step-grandchildren and two step-great grandchildren also survive.

Six brothers and two sisters also preceded her in death.

She was a member of the St. Joseph Catholic Church in Highland, Ladies Sodality and TOPS.

Visitation will be Tuesday, September 19th from 4-9 p.m. and Wednesday, September 20th from 6:30-8:55 a.m. at the Young and Sons Funeral Home in Perryville. A Catholic wake will be held at 7 p.m. Tuesday, September 19th, at the funeral home.

A funeral for 89-year-old Martha L. Lukefahr of Highland will be held at 9:30 a.m. Wednesday, September 20th at the St. Joseph Catholic Church. Burial will be in the church cemetery. The Rev. Robert Brockland will officiate.

Memorials may be made to masses or to pro life.

 

Printed in the Sun-Times newspaper, Perryville, MO
